Tech Shifts Driving Value: Layer-2s, Dynamic Metadata, and Smart Drops

The rapid evolution of underlying infrastructure is reshaping NFT value through Layer-2 scaling, dynamic metadata capabilities, and smarter distribution models such as automated drops.

Industry analysis shows Layer-2 scaling reduces costs and speeds minting, while dynamic metadata enables post-murchase evolution.

Firms pursue smarter drops to optimize retention, bidding dynamics, and liquidity, aligning creator incentives with market demand and freedom to iterate.
